Forbes, J.D. (1809-1868)

The papers of James David Forbes (1809-1868), Principal of the United Colleges of St Andrews University from 1859-1868. A large collection, primarily of correspondence, containing several thousand letters on scientific and personal matters, many of the correspondents being the most eminent scientists of Forbes' day. There are also notebooks and diaries of expeditions to the Alps, Switzerland, Italy and Norway. Forbes' interests included meteorology, electricity, mountain climbing and glacier theory, and his papers make an important contribution to the history of science.
